When it comes to interior design, even small decisions can greatly impact the overall atmosphere of a space. Avoiding common blunders can aid you design a beautiful and functional home. One frequent error is choosing Design Pitfalls furniture that's too large for the space. This can make the space feel cramped, and hinder movement. Conversely, incorporating too much tiny furniture can cause a vacant aesthetic.
- Another pitfall is overloading a room with accessories. While a few well-chosen adornments can enhance the design, too many can be distracting.
- Don't forget to consider the use of each room when selecting furniture and items.
By avoiding these frequent mistakes, you can develop a home that is both stylish and usable.

Mastering Home Decor: Mistakes to Avoid for a Stylish Space
Creating a home elegant space is a rewarding journey, but it's easy to fall into common pitfalls. To achieve a cohesive and refined aesthetic, avoid these essential errors.
First and foremost, avoid the temptation to clutter your space. Utilize negative area to create a sense of peace. When picking furniture, prioritize longevity over quantity. Invest in less statement pieces that will remain timeless rather than acquiring a multitude of average items.
Finally, don't neglect the influence of lighting. Strategic lighting can enhance a space, creating an comfortable ambiance.
